Both alcohol and THC (the main intoxicating compound in cannabis) change how you think, feel, and move. Both can impair driving, reaction time, and decision-making, and neither is risk-free. Health experts are very clear: there is no truly “safe” substance here — only different risk profiles and patterns of use.
Alcohol:
Linked to liver damage, heart disease, high blood pressure, and several cancers
Can be physically addictive and cause dangerous withdrawal in heavy users
Even “moderate” drinking has been associated with increased cancer risk
Cannabis:
Can help some people relax, boost mood, or ease discomfort — which is why some medical cannabis products are used for conditions like chronic pain or multiple sclerosis, though always under medical guidance
Can also affect heart health, memory, and mental health, especially with heavy or long-term use
Can lead to dependence and withdrawal symptoms (irritability, sleep issues, cravings) for some people

Why Some Adults Prefer Cannabis Over Alcohol
When used thoughtfully and in moderation, cannabis can offer a different kind of “unwinding” experience than alcohol:
Fewer classic hangover symptoms
Many people report less next-day nausea, dehydration, and headache with cannabis compared to a heavy night of drinking. You might still feel groggy if you overdo it, but it’s usually different than an alcohol hangover.No empty liquid calories
Beer, wine, and cocktails can add up to hundreds of calories in a night; alcohol also affects blood sugar and appetite. Many cannabis options — especially low-dose edibles, tinctures, and vapes — involve far fewer calories (or none at all), though snacks can still add up afterward.More precise dosing options
With a 5 mg or 2.5 mg edible, it’s easier to repeat a similar experience each time once you learn how your body responds. Alcohol effects can vary more depending on food, hydration, and how fast you drink.New social rituals
Cannabis beverages, shared pre-rolls, or a small edible before a movie can create social rituals that feel similar to “grabbing a drink,” but without the same alcohol-related harms for some people.

Choosing Cannabis Products as an Alcohol Alternative
If you’re curious about replacing some of your alcohol with cannabis, product choice and dosing are everything. A few guidelines:
Start with low-dose edibles or beverages
Cannabis edibles and drinkables can be a great “glass of wine replacement,” but they work very differently:
Edibles and infused drinks can take 30–120 minutes to kick in
Effects can peak around 2–3 hours and last 4–6 hours or longer Wikipedia
Because of this, the golden rule is “start low, go slow”:
New consumers: start with 2–2.5 mg THC
Many regulars stay around 5 mg THC for a light, social effect
Wait a full 2 hours before deciding whether to take more
You can also look for products that combine THC + CBD for a more balanced, less “edgy” experience.
Consider inhalable options for more control
For some adults, a 1–2 puff session from a pre-roll or vape feels closer to a quick drink:
Onset in minutes
Easier to “pause” once you feel where you’re at
Shorter duration compared to a heavy edible session

Using Cannabis Responsibly When You’re Cutting Back on Alcohol
Even if cannabis feels like a better fit than alcohol, it still demands respect.
Do:
Keep it 21+ only, and store products locked away from kids and pets
Avoid mixing high amounts of cannabis and alcohol — it can increase impairment and anxiety
Clear your schedule the first few times you try a new product or dose
Talk with a healthcare provider if you have heart disease, are on medications, or have a personal or family history of mental health conditions
Do not use cannabis if:
You are pregnant, trying to conceive, or breastfeeding
You’ll be driving, operating machinery, or performing safety-sensitive work
You have been advised by a medical professional to avoid it
You’re under 21
If you have a history of substance use disorder (alcohol or anything else), changing one substance for another can be complicated. In that case, it’s important to speak with an addiction specialist or counselor before using cannabis as an “alcohol alternative.” SAMHSA+1
